This course provides a comprehensive overview of sediment impact assessments for channel design and restoration projects. Highlighted, is the importance of sediment impact assessments in determining the potential for sediment deposition or scouring on the channel bed, which can impact the success of the project. Also covered are the types of sediment impact assessments that can be used, ranging from visual techniques for simple projects to numerical models for complex projects, as well as the importance of a bed stability assessment to determine the anticipated channel bed response and the potential for aggradation or degradation.
